How much do debt collector jobs pay per hour?

As of May 31, 2026, the average hourly pay for debt collector in Decatur, GA is $17.95,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.00 and $19.47 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What Is a Debt Collector?

The job of a debt collector is to collect on a debt that a person owes, like a late credit card or mortgage payment. They often work for a debt collection agency or for a creditor who is seeking a debtor. Their duties may entail finding the debtor, contacting them by phone or mail, and negotiating payments. Debt collection is regulated by the federal government. Collection agencies may use internal collectors or contract out to another firm.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Debt Collector,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Debt Collector, you need strong negotiation abilities, knowledge of debt collection laws, and typically a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with customer relationship management (CRM) software, phone systems, and payment processing tools is often required. Excellent communication, resilience, and problem-solving skills help build rapport with clients and handle challenging conversations. These competencies are crucial for maximizing debt recovery while maintaining compliance and positive client relations.

What are some common challenges faced by debt collectors, and how can they handle them effectively?

Debt collectors often encounter challenges such as dealing with uncooperative or distressed customers, meeting collection targets, and managing high call volumes. Effective communication and strong negotiation skills are key to overcoming these obstacles, as is maintaining professionalism and empathy during difficult conversations. Many organizations provide training and support to help collectors handle objections, comply with regulations, and manage stress, making it important for job seekers to seek out employers with robust support systems.

What are debt collectors?

Debt collectors are professionals or agencies hired by creditors to recover unpaid debts from individuals or businesses. They contact debtors by phone, mail, or email to arrange payment plans or settlements. Debt collectors must follow specific laws and regulations, such as the Fair Debt Collection Practices Act (FDCPA) in the United States, to ensure ethical practices. Their main goal is to recover as much of the owed amount as possible while maintaining professionalism and compliance with the law.

What qualifications do I need to be a debt collector?

To become a debt collector, candidates typically need a high school diploma or equivalent. Employers often require good communication skills, some knowledge of debt collection laws, and may provide on-the-job training; a valid driver’s license can also be beneficial for fieldwork. Certification is not mandatory but can enhance job prospects and credibility in the field.

What is the difference between Debt Collector vs Credit Analyst?

AspectDebt CollectorCredit Analyst
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ma; sometimes certifications in collectionsBachelor's degree in finance, accounting, or related field
Work EnvironmentCollections agencies, banks, or healthcare providersBanks, financial institutions, or credit bureaus
Employer & Industry UsagePrimarily in debt recovery and collectionsInvolved in assessing creditworthiness and risk analysis
Common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ding debt recovery rolesEvaluating credit risk and financial health

While both roles are involved in finance, a Debt Collector focuses on recovering unpaid debts, often working directly with delinquent accounts. A Credit Analyst assesses creditworthiness to determine lending risks. The roles differ in responsibilities, credentials, and work environments, but both are essential in financial operations.

Job Summary

The Collections Specialist is responsible for ensuring that the company receives all necessary payments from debtors. Their duties include monitoring accounts receivable statements to identify debts owed to their company, contacting customers or business partners to notify them of overdue payments and documenting debts collected.

Duties amp; Responsibilities

· Corresponding with customers that have a past due balance either by phone, email, or mail.

· Sending statements or invoices and figuring out different payment methods.

· Working with customers to resolve their past due account and update any information that is relevant to billing.

· Keeping either a log or notes of customers contacted and what was discussed.

· Notifying our billing team of any errors and working in house to resolve those errors.

· Working with General Managers and sales to figure out the best approach with certain customers.

· Working to reduce our overall bad debt risk.

Qualifications

· Finance/Accounting experience preferred but not a must.

· At least 3 + years’ experience in customer service is required.

· Must be able to work in a fast-paced work environment.

· Must be able to operate general office equipment.

· Effective problem-solving skills.

· Ability to handle conflict and resolution.

· Ability to learn a new system relativity quickly.

· Organized and a great note taker.

Physical Requirements amp; Working Conditions

· Must be able to talk, listen, and speak clearly on telephone.

· Job is primarily sedentary, minimal physical effort/lifting – up to 10 pounds.

· Office environment.

· No travel is required for this job.
